Independent Power and Renewable Energy LLC (IPRE)

IPRE is a consulting and development company located in Southern Maine. Its Principal, William Franks, has more than 50 years’ experience in the USA, Europe and the Far East. Mr. Franks played a key role for the European Bank for Reconstruction and Development developing the conditionality for loans to complete the Rivne and Khmelnitsky pressurized water nuclear reactors. He also has project development expertise, including nuclear commodity procurement (uranium and SWU), project finance, biogas development, and energy storage.

Regarding EBRD, closure of the last operating units at Chernobyl was a condition of the loans. He was also EBRD’s representative who, together with the European Union, oversaw the privatization of the Ukrainian local electric distribution companies.

Rail Energy Storage

Commuter Rail Energy Savings

A study of the energy savings potential on the Long Island Railroad employing Stornetic flywheels for recovering energy from recuperative braking.

Rail Energy Storage

Metro Energy Savings

A study of energy savings potential on the New York City Transit System for recovering energy from recuperative braking on New York City subways. This included preparing applications to New York Energy Research and Development Authority for a proof of concept demonstration. This work is ongoing.

Grid Stabilization

Micro Grid

A study of frequency control for the New Jersey TransitGrid employing Stornetic flywheels on a large microgrid that New Jersey Transit will construct using FTA financing.
